    @hellnbak said: ......., and since I never had the plugin installed before I would really like to know how that feature got turned on in the first place....... Even if you never had 'Solar North' installed on your computer, you could stiil be stuck with that orange line in your model. That is when downloading a model with the line activated (and maybe rotated to the new solar north). It may sound silly but yes, that's the way it happens. The way to get rid of it is to have someone re-upload the same model without orange solar north for you to download, or to install the plugin yourself. p.s.     @pipingguy said: OK - here is my understanding: To modify a color in a custom collection: Tools menu > Paint Bucket. Display the secondary pane by clicking the icon directly below the exit button. In the secondary pane, scroll thru the drop-down list and choose the custom library. In the primary pane, scroll thru the drop-down list and choose the “In Model” library. Or, if you're lazy, click on the little house icon to the left of the drop down list. @pipingguy said: In the secondary pane, right-click the color icon that you want to adjust and pick ‘Add to model’. Said color icon now appears in the Model Library; click it and then click the Edit tab. Adjust color and/or transparency……also rename if you wish. Click the Select tab Drag the color icon back into the Custom Library and choose ‘overwrite’ when prompted. No need to do anything else. You can exit SketchUp without even needing to save the drawing. The modified color will appear in the Custom Library when you re-start the program. Note- if you change color transparency, do not expect the color icon, when it’s displayed in the custom library, to show the two-tone diagonal slash as normally shown in non-custom palettes.     @fredo6 said: ThruPaint does not provide continous textures across different groups. Actually, the best is to use the native Projected mode of the Paint tool, which, I believe use an absolute origin for texture positioning. Fredo One think that does work across different (nested) groups with native tools is to reposition the texture and drag each red pin to a one mutual location (endpoint of a basic edge or guidepoint in plane! of faces) further down and to the left of all included geometry (thus all the basic and grouped (nested) faces that need to be painted correctly). So all these faces would then have their red pin located at the same [X,Y,Z] location. For me it worked in you model. Tedious to do though and I had to reset one texture of a nested face. Probably a plugin would be able to dig trough the (nested) geometry to do all the faces in a certain plain with the same defined/selected material.     Sadly, burkhard's expreience sums up our own. We got one in at work for our software development team to look into - after a few hours playing with the provided examples, it went into a drawer, never to be seen again, without so much as a line of 'integration code' being written. Even in the videos, you can see how slowly everyone does everything. It looks like it ought to be intuitive, but everyone's opinion here was the same - you seem to need to develop some kind of special motor skills that don't come very naturally (hopefully before your arms drop off from fatigue!). The idea is really sweet, but the actual experience of every single one of us was "gimme my mouse back!". One has to wonder wonder just just how much practice the demonstrator's had, and how many takes it took to make their marketing videos! As you say "pushing the boundaries", and surely the technology will improve. However, consider this... 'Gestural' technology is not as new as all that. The Theremin (wave your hands in the air musical instrument) is getting on for a century old. Moog had a good stab at popularising it, it was used by many composers (lots of cool sci-fi movie soundtracks especially!), and they're cheap as chips to make. Yet, theremin players are rare as hen's teeth - and ones that can play in tune and expressively rarer still!

    @box said: To be honest Hellnbak, if you have really decided you want to use SU8 then I think the easiest way to restore SU8 as the default is to uninstall 2015 and reboot so that SU8 is recognised and works. Then reinstall 2015 making sure during the installation to tell it not to be the default. From memory it does give you that option during the install process. You can rename the .exe to force things to work but it can get confusing. But I'm fairly certain that 2015 respects the default choice during install. I remember that when I installed it I chose not to have it as default and kept 2014, then when I wanted it to be default I had problems so just reinstalled and made the choice. One of the other new additions (I think) is the ability to right click on a file and choose which version you want to open it with, directly in the context menu. I think you misunderstood.
